альтернатива устаревшему методу Orientdb getVertexByKey() в версии 2.2.10?

Я использую Orientdb 2.2.10

Чего я хочу?

Я хочу получить вершину, имеющую uId = 'ram' of classtype = "Person" из моей Graphdb.

Мой graphdb проиндексирован с уникальным ключом uid.

Как я могу это решить?

  • Я использую эту функцию для получения вершины: graph.getVertexByKey(key);
  • Я получаю желаемый результат, но моя IDE (eclipse) показывает его как устаревший метод

Есть ли альтернатива этому в 2.2.10?

Если нет, безопасно ли его использовать?

Спасибо


person Prakash Pandey    schedule 12.10.2016    source источник


Ответы (1)


Вы можете использовать:

Iterable<Vertex> it=g.getVertices("uid", "ram");

Надеюсь, поможет.

С Уважением.

person Michela Bonizzi    schedule 12.10.2016
comment
Спасибо за ответы..! - person Prakash Pandey; 12.10.2016
comment
любой метод, который возвращает Vertex напрямую вместо Iterable? - person Prakash Pandey; 12.10.2016